// Security review context: this client talks to Gatewright, the service that
// enforces our canary deploy gating rules. A canary is promoted only if error
// rate stays under 0.5% and p99 latency under 250ms for 30 consecutive
// minutes; either breach triggers automatic rollback via the Rollstone
// controller. Note that gating decisions are signed and audited — do not
// bypass this client with raw HTTP calls. Gatewright authentication uses the
// key immediately below.

API key for fawif-tagug: zpat23_QjTqt2Aqb25emwQY8KmpH4K

## Account Recovery — Trailnote Offline Mode

When a surveyor's Trailnote app has been offline for 30+ days, their local credentials expire and sync refuses to resume. Don't make them wipe the device — all their unsynced field data lives there! Instead, open the support console, pick "Offline Reinstate," and enter their handle. The console will ask for the support team's shared recovery passphrase before issuing a reinstatement token. Use the one below.

unlock words, bagaf-fajeg: zorael-kelax-fraath-quenix-eliok-sileth-aldmir-wenir-druiel

TrailMark field-survey app now supports full offline operation. Survey forms, basemap tiles, and media attachments are cached locally on first sync; edits queue in a local store and reconcile on reconnect using last-write-wins with conflict flags surfaced in the review queue. Storage is capped at 2GB per device, configurable in settings. Known limitation: photo uploads over 50MB are deferred until a Wi-Fi connection is detected. Maintenance questions and future changes to the sync layer should be directed to the feature owner.

account owner for bawip-tahag: Raleth Quenok

Hey team — handing over Flagwright, our rollout framework, to support while I'm out. Most tickets are just stuck percentage ramps; nudge the evaluator and they clear. If someone reports flags frozen entirely, the rules store has probably sealed itself after a node flap. You can unseal it yourselves from the support console, no need to page engineering. The recovery passphrase the console asks for is written right below this note.

vault phrase of bagaf-kajeg = jorath-feniel-briir-siliel-ralix